Output 751518a9984a50ae606a3736d1efc5c3fcb5f1130286c7733fa5574a41129b7a:99

value
261861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85556b0461e3cdc4a20a10abf3861a63528260dc OP_EQUAL
address
3Dr281KenrzWkWVuHFxYQpdwM5tUKNBVSz
transaction
751518a9984a50ae606a3736d1efc5c3fcb5f1130286c7733fa5574a41129b7a
spent
true